Expert Review
Our team found that travel nursing roles like this one often come with excellent pay but can involve significant logistical challenges. The advertised salary of $2,386 per week is appealing, but securing housing and transport can be tricky. Many travel nurses report difficulties in finding suitable accommodations close to their assignments.
Customer service from agencies like Malone Healthcare can vary — some nurses have faced delays in response times, especially during peak hiring seasons. It's crucial to clarify your contract terms upfront to avoid misunderstandings later. Unlike many local nursing jobs, this travel position offers the chance to work in diverse settings, which can enhance your resume and experience.
